WUE (Western Undergraduate Exchange) Scholarships

These scholarships are for students in Western States reduced tuition (in-state tuition + 50%) for those students who meet criteria for the scholarship and apply before the yearly allotment is taken.  (see individual University eligibility requirements that range from 2.5-3.8 GPA with or without qualifying SAT or ACT scores) The savings can be between $4,000- $7,000 /year.

The American Legion Scholarship Programs


Education is the cornerstone upon which the future of this nation is built. Where there are good schools, we find good citizens. In fact, education is the first requisite of good citizenship. Reliable studies show many American students are unaware of all the financial assistance available to them in pursuit of higher education. The American Legion's Scholarship Programs were created to fill that void, and to promote and provide programs that encourage children to make use of their education opportunities.

Camp $tart-Up…..Become your own boss

Camp $tart-Up® offers teens (ages 14-18) the opportunity to exercise your entrepreneurial spirit through a fun, fast, practical, hands-on learning experience that develops confidence and leadership skills. You’ll learn how to translate your interests and dreams into enterprise and independence. Learn more www.independentmeans.com
